Take a dip in the sea 🌊
The water usually sits at around 15°C in September, so it’s still warm enough for a swim if you’re feeling brave. We’d recommend heading in just before or after high or low tide, when the currents are usually calmer.
Our walk of the month: West Runton 🥾
Head towards Beeston Bump, climb to the top, then follow the clifftop path east towards West Runton. It’s around three miles, with lovely coastal views and the promise of a well-earned cuppa at the café when you arrive.
Sheringham 1940s Weekend 🎺
One of the town’s biggest events of the year, with vintage music, fashion, classic vehicles and plenty of nostalgia as Sheringham steps back in time.
